MANI(A)C!
Have you ever taken in a homeless man off the street? … Or been hit and flipped by a car and got up laughing and continued crossing the road? ... Or woken up to a fireman lifting you out of the house because you got drunk and left the stove on? …
Jack Lynch shares the stories — the funny, the farces and the fallouts — from manic and depressive episodes of life.
A comedic and heartfelt musical cabaret from a (sometimes) self-confessed Mani(a)c!

Jack Lynch is a Melbourne based composer, singer, piano player and cabaret artist. He has previously performed his original show 'Confessions from the Bell Jar', inspired by the life and art of Sylvia Plath at the Melbourne Fringe, Adelaide Fringe and the Empire Theatre in Toowoomba. His new work, 'MANI(A)C!' explores his experiences of living with bi-polar disorder through song, comedy and story.
